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

From the 1930s to the 1970s, asbestos law was widely used in construction materials. It was used in pipe insulation and fireproofing, as well as cements, plasters, car breaks, and much more. Exposure to this toxic material can lead to several serious medical conditions, including mesothelioma, as well as other respiratory illnesses.

A licensed New York mesothelioma lawyer can help victims seek compensation from the companies responsible for their exposure. It is crucial to select the right lawyer for this type of claim.

Find a specialist

When asbestos is mined and processed the tiny fibers split easily and are able to be inhaled. This can lead to mesothelioma, lung cancer, and asbestosis. Workers who handle the mineral directly are more at risk, however anyone can inhale asbestos. This type of exposure, also known as secondary exposure, can affect anyone around the worker's contaminated clothing or equipment. This includes family members who wash the uniform and those who live in the same house. This can happen on military bases and ships in which employees wear the same clothing for a long time.

Workers in construction, insulation, shipyards, milling, mining and other jobs can be exposed to asbestos. This was especially true in the United States from the 1950s until the 1990s. Workers were exposed to asbestos when older buildings were demolished or renovated as well as when building materials were damaged. materials were used. Even today, demolition and remodeling in older buildings can release asbestos into the air.

It could be a long time between exposure to asbestos and the onset mesothelioma symptoms or other signs. If you suspect that you may be suffering from a disease related to asbestos or have been exposed to asbestos it is crucial to talk with an expert.

Your doctor will examine your lungs and ask about any work history which may have involved asbestos. If they suspect that you may have an asbestos-related illness, they will likely refer you to a specialist for additional tests. Asbestos-related illnesses can be detected through chest X-rays or CT scans. However, they might not show up in these tests.

These diseases can affect the lungs, the heart and abdomen. It is not common for mesothelioma to develops in the brain.

Report Your Suspicion to Your Employer

Asbestos is a fibrous, brittle material utilized in a variety of industrial processes because of its resistance to heat, flexibility, and strength. Unfortunately, asbestos is also the cause of numerous serious health issues, including mesothelioma and lung cancer. These illnesses can be painful, debilitating and even fatal. Anyone who has been exposed to asbestos could be entitled to compensation. A successful lawsuit could be used to pay medical bills as well as lost wages, home care costs, and many other expenses.

Workers who have come into contact with asbestos should immediately notify the health professional of any symptoms. This is particularly important for construction workers who are often exposed to asbestos while renovating old buildings. These buildings were constructed before asbestos was recognized as a carcinogen hazard and could contain unsafe levels of asbestos.

Exposure to asbestos can lead to various diseases, and the signs of these illnesses generally do not show up until 25 to 50 years after the exposure. Anyone who has been exposed to asbestos should visit their doctor regularly for health checks. This is the best way to avoid asbestos-related illnesses or to recognize early warning indicators.

Some people are at greater risk of exposure to asbestos than others. For example, Navy veterans may have been exposed to asbestos when working on ships or in other military facilities. Asbestos has also been found in those who work with shipyards, heating systems, construction or automotive industry.

There are a variety of agencies that set guidelines and laws for employers to follow when it comes to asbestos in the workplace. If you believe your employer isn't following these standards, you can contact the Occupational Safety and Health Administration for more information or an inspection.

In addition, certain veterans who have served in the United States Armed Forces may be qualified for disability compensation. Veterans who are eligible are able to submit a claim to the VA for benefits relating to asbestos exposure during service.

Claim Your Claim

Your attorney will take your health records and employment records to create a timeline for your asbestos exposure. They will then build your case by collecting evidence that proves you were exposed to asbestos and that the exposure caused you harm. The complaint will be sent to every defendant and they will have 30 days in which to respond. Defendants will often deny their responsibility and might even attempt to blame someone else. This is why you need an attorney team that know how to manage these claims.

When your attorney has all the documentation required they will file your asbestos case. They will file the lawsuit in the state court that is most suitable for your case. During this time, the attorneys will gather evidence and conduct discovery where they exchange information with the opposing side about the case. If a trial is ordered, they will also represent you in the trial. However, the majority of cases are resolved through an asbestos settlement.

It is essential to employ a mesothelioma expert because asbestos litigation is distinct from other personal injury claims. They have access to a database that informs patients what specific asbestos products they were exposed to while on the job. This allows patients to identify the products at fault for their exposure.

Additionally, they'll know which companies are accountable for your exposure, which includes the manufacturers of the asbestos-containing products you handled and even the property owners of buildings containing as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os-contaminated products.
